Free shipping on UK orders over £49 (excluding certain special products).Terms & conditions apply.

Read More →

Our China HQ is closed February 12–25 for Chinese New Year. International orders and support outside the UK may experience delays.

ACS Camera & Pro Video

North America USA
Address 159 New Hyde Park Road, Franklin sq NY 11010
Tel (516) 460-8243
Website http://www.acscamera.com/